About Antalya:
Antalya and its surrounding is an important and noteworthy touristic center on the Mediterranean Coast with its perfect climate and splendid harmony of archaeological, historical and natural beauties, throughout the year available.
You may reach Antalya from almost every city of the country, and even from little towns, coach companies going to Antalya are available. Antalya has an international airport which may connect you to major cities. It has modern facilities including waiting rooms, restaurants, cafe bars, and a shopping

Before reserving this property (ref. ANTV192A), foreign buyers typically confirm unit availability, pay a reservation deposit, obtain a Turkish tax number, open a bank account, and complete the Foreign Exchange Purchase Certificate (DAB) ahead of the Title Deed (TAPU) appointment at the land registry.
For foreign buyers, the purchase process usually involves budgeting beyond the listed price: approximately 4% title deed transfer fee, land registry costs, mandatory DASK insurance, notary and sworn translator fees, and utility setup should be planned before reservation.
After the Title Deed (TAPU) is issued, owners should plan for annual property tax (emlak vergisi), monthly aidat in complexes, utilities, insurance, and optional property management — especially for overseas owners who let or visit intermittently.

For villa buyers planning long-term family use, inheritance and succession rules for foreign-owned property in Turkey should be reviewed with a qualified adviser early — especially where multiple heirs or cross-border estates are involved.
If you later decide to sell, holding period, district liquidity, and the five-year capital gains rule affect net proceeds. Realistic pricing, Title Deed (TAPU) readiness, and presentation usually matter more than quick discounting when exiting.
